Preguntas frecuentes sobre Lincoln Square

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Lincoln Square?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Lincoln Square varian entre $1,275 y $1,895 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,646

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Lincoln Square?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Lincoln Square van desde $1,800 hasta $2,550.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,985

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Lincoln Square?

En estos momentos hay 45 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Lincoln Square en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,090 y $2,900 - con una media de $2,406 para el lugar.
